《Born of the Bones》


Born of the Bones explores the quiet transformation of remnants into renewal. Drawing inspiration from skeletal forms, the work pieces together fragments of the body to form branches—structures once rigid and lifeless now bearing delicate blossoms. It reflects on how life often grows out of what has been lost, broken, or left behind. Through the process of hand-building and firing, the ceramic form becomes both relic and rebirth, suggesting that decay and beauty are not opposites, but companions in the ongoing cycle of existence.

Year of Creation: 2025

Materials: ceramic

Dimensions: 38.00*20.00*18.00cm,35.00*28.00*15.00cm,40.00*20.00*22.00cm
